Error -200197

After the self-test (using DAQmx 9.0 on Windows XP) on a DAQcard 6024E returned error 200020, I tried the Diagnostic Utility test v1.0. This returns the following error message:

 

An internal error has occurred.

Error -200197 occurred at Property Node DAQmx Device (arg 5) in Get Device Param.vi->Diagnostic Utility SubVi.vi->Diagnostic Utility.vi

Possible reason(s):

Device does not support this property.

 

Any ideas what this is about?
